Output 8cbe2cb2bc24667e3ee996643e9d95b15d636e6def0eb77f9af0c5b24cf8c173:3

value
2850419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02aabcb1df66b568d2132e808756f88d9edd1bda OP_EQUAL
address
31w7owxU5cLXjuP4o5sDBT85YrMrkbHXup
transaction
8cbe2cb2bc24667e3ee996643e9d95b15d636e6def0eb77f9af0c5b24cf8c173
spent
true